圖解係統分析與設計(第二版增訂版)(附範例光碟) 

圖解係統分析與設計(第二版增訂版)(附範例光碟)  pdf epub mobi txt 电子书 下载 2025

李春雄 
圖書標籤:
  • 係統分析
  • 係統設計
  • 軟件工程
  • 信息係統
  • 圖解
  • 教材
  • 第二版
  • 增訂版
  • 範例光碟
  • 計算機科學
想要找书就要到 灣灣書站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

圖書描述

  本書詳盡的介紹的係統分析的理論、分析、設計與維護等,採用圖文並茂的方式說明「係統分析」的概念與知識,且每個單元後附有與該單元相關的評量測驗與「丙級電腦軟體應用」的題庫,讓讀者可以快速的瞭解係統分析與設計,以啟發學習動機;另可搭配本書上架至Google Play的「係統分析」的行動教材,增加學習的便利性。

本書特色

  1.全國第一本上架到Google Play的「係統分析」行動教材。
  2.本書附有丙級電腦軟體應用題庫。
  3.每一章的最前麵都有引言來說明學習目標,以啟發學習動機。
  4.利用圖文並茂來說明「係統分析」的概念知識。
  5.每「單元」後附有單元導嚮來評量測驗。讓授課老師可以針對某一單元來命題。
  6.每「章節」最後附有「基本題」與「進階題」課後的適性化評量機製,協助讀者課後練習與自我測驗。
 
探索現代企業的數位轉型基石:高效能係統建構與管理實務指南 本書特色: 本書深入淺齣地剖析瞭當代企業在數位化浪潮下,如何運用結構化思維與先進技術,成功規劃、設計、實施與維護複雜資訊係統的完整歷程。我們專注於提供一套實用且可操作的係統分析與設計方法論,旨在提升決策品質、優化業務流程,並最終實現組織的競爭力飛躍。全書內容緊密結閤業界最新趨勢,涵蓋瞭從需求探勘到係統部署的關鍵環節,是IT專業人士、係統分析師、專案經理以及資訊管理學生的必備參考書。 第一部分:係統思維與需求工程——奠定堅實基礎 本部分著重於建立正確的係統思維模式,理解資訊係統在現代組織中的策略地位。我們探討瞭係統生命週期(SDLC)的各個階段,並強調在初始階段進行精確的需求獲取與分析是係統成功的關鍵。 第一章:資訊係統的本質與角色 深入解析資訊係統在不同企業功能(如營運、管理、決策)中的作用。探討企業架構(Enterprise Architecture, EA)的基本概念,以及資訊係統如何成為驅動業務變革的核心引擎。討論資訊科技如何影響產業結構、競爭優勢和商業模式的創新。 第二章:係統分析的策略視角 介紹如何從組織戰略層麵齣發,評估潛在係統專案的商業價值與可行性。詳細闡述專案的 iniciation 階段,包括問題界定、機會識別以及建立初步的商業論證(Business Case)。著重於非功能性需求(如效能、安全性、可用性)與功能性需求的區分與同等重視。 第三章:先進的需求獲取技術 係統性地介紹多種需求獲取技術,包括深度訪談、焦點小組(Focus Group)、問捲調查、文件審閱、工作流程觀察與競品分析。重點解析如何有效地麵對利益相關者(Stakeholders)之間的衝突需求,並運用情境工程(Contextual Inquiry)等方法,深入挖掘潛在且未被明確錶達的需求。引入使用者故事(User Stories)和用例(Use Cases)的撰寫標準與最佳實踐。 第四章:需求分析與規格說明 探討需求分析的工具與技術,如流程建模、數據建模和物件建模的基礎。重點闡述如何將模糊的業務需求轉化為清晰、無歧義的係統規格。詳細介紹需求追蹤矩陣(Requirements Traceability Matrix, RTM)的建立與維護,確保每個功能需求都能對應到特定的業務目標。 第二部分:係統設計——從藍圖到結構 本部分將焦點轉嚮如何將分析階段確立的需求轉化為可實施的技術藍圖。我們將區分概念設計、邏輯設計與物理設計的層次。 第五章:結構化設計方法論的應用 迴顧結構化分析與設計(Structured Analysis and Design Technique, SADT)的核心原則。詳細介紹資料流圖(Data Flow Diagrams, DFD)的分層分解方法,從零層到更高層次的分解過程,以及如何利用過程描述(Process Specifications)來定義係統的運作邏輯。 第六章:物件導嚮係統設計(OOD)的實踐 深入探討物件導嚮分析與設計(OOAD)的理論基礎,重點講解統一建模語言(UML)在係統設計中的核心應用。詳細解析類圖(Class Diagrams)、物件互動圖(Sequence Diagrams)、活動圖(Activity Diagrams)和狀態機圖(State Machine Diagrams)的繪製規範與解讀方式。如何利用設計模式(Design Patterns)來解決常見的軟體設計難題,提升代碼的可重用性與可維護性。 第七章:資料庫設計與實體關係建模 係統性地介紹關聯式資料庫設計的規範。從實體關係模型(ERD)的建立開始,講解如何識別實體、屬性、關係,並定義基數與限製。深入探討正規化(Normalization)的各個層級(1NF, 2NF, 3NF, BCNF),確保資料庫結構的完整性與最小冗餘。討論資料庫設計在邏輯層麵與物理層麵(如索引、分區策略)的考量。 第八章:使用者介麵(UI/UX)的設計原則 探討以使用者為中心的設計(User-Centered Design, UCD)理念。涵蓋介麵設計的十大原則,如一緻性、反饋機製、錯誤預防與恢復。介紹如何設計有效的導航結構、資訊架構和互動元素,並探討響應式設計(Responsive Design)的基本要求,以確保係統在不同設備上的良好用戶體驗。 第三部分:實施、測試與維護——確保係統品質與生命週期管理 本部分關注設計的實現過程,以及如何通過嚴謹的測試和有效的維護策略來保障係統的長期穩定運行與業務適應性。 第九章:係統建構與技術選型 討論在物理設計階段,應當如何根據需求規格和設計藍圖進行技術堆棧的選擇。涉及硬體基礎設施、作業係統、應用程式框架及程式語言的選型考量。簡述開發環境的建立、配置管理與版本控製的標準流程。 第十章:係統測試的策略與執行 詳述不同層級的測試方法,包括單元測試(Unit Testing)、整閤測試(Integration Testing)、係統測試(System Testing)與使用者驗收測試(User Acceptance Testing, UAT)。重點介紹測試案例的設計方法,如何基於需求規格和控製流程圖來設計邊界值分析和等價類劃分等有效測試用例。討論測試自動化工具的應用。 第十一章:係統部署與變革管理 分析從開發環境到生產環境的平穩過渡策略,包括「大爆炸法」、「並行實施」和「分階段實施」等部署模式的優劣。探討變革管理的必要性,包括使用者培訓計畫的製定、文件編寫與技術交接的標準化流程,以最大化新係統的採用率。 第十二章:係統的評估、運行與維護 探討係統上線後的監控、性能評估與日誌管理。詳細區分預防性、糾正性、適應性與完善性維護的類型。介紹如何建立有效的係統績效指標(KPIs)來持續衡量係統的商業價值和技術健康度。討論係統汰換與升級的決策依據。 結語:麵嚮未來的係統思維 總結現代係統分析與設計中對敏捷方法(Agile)、DevOps理念的整閤與藉鑒,強調係統分析師在快速變化的技術環境中持續學習和適應變革的重要性。本書旨在培養讀者具備「全局觀」和「細節控」的雙重能力,從容應對複雜的資訊係統建構挑戰。

著者信息

作者簡介

李春雄


  ■學歷:國立颱灣科技大學
  資訊管理博士

  ■服務學校:正修科技大學
  資訊管理係

  ■專長科目:
  □AI 人工智慧開發與實務應用
  □IOT 物聯網開發與實務應用
  □雲端資料庫整閤開發與實務應用
  □機器人與物聯網整閤開發與實務應用

  ■榮譽:
  □2021國立颱灣科技大學傑齣校友
  □2020颱灣十大傑齣發明傢獎
  □2020國際傑齣發明傢終身成就獎
  □2019國際傑齣發明傢名人堂

  ■研究
  □手機App程式設計
  □機器人輔助程式設計
  □STEAM與創客教育
 

圖書目錄

第 1 章 資訊係統開發概論
1-1 為何企業需要資訊係統?
1-2 資訊係統與企業組織的關係
1-3 何謂資訊係統?
1-4 電腦化資訊係統
1-5 資訊係統開發的內外環境
第 2 章 資訊係統開發方法
2-1 資訊係統生命週期概論
2-2 係統發展生命週期(SDLC)
2-3 瀑布模式 (Waterfall Model)
2-4 雛型模式(Prototype Model
2-5 漸增模式(Incremental Model)
2-6 螺鏇模式(Spiral Model)
2-7 同步模式(Concurrent Model)
第 3 章 調查規劃
3-1 資訊係統之專案計劃的起始原因
3-2 調查規劃
3-3 瞭解現行作業環境
3-4 蒐集係統背景資料
3-5 定義新係統的範圍與目標
3-6 訂立新係統工作時程
3-7 提齣可行性及選擇最佳方案
3-8 撰寫「初步分析報告書」
3-9 實例探討與研究
第 4 章 係統分析
4-1 係統分析的概念
4-2 獲得使用者需求
4-3 數值分析法
4-4 資料流程分析
4-5 撰寫「軟體需求規格書」
4-6 實例探討與研究
第 5 章 流程塑模(DFD)
5-1 資料流程圖
5-2 資料流程圖的基本符號
5-3 資料流程圖的功能分解
5-4 係統環境圖(概圖)的繪製
5-5 主要功能圖
5-6 嚮下階層化
5-7 嚮上階層化
5-8 資料流程圖之繪製原則
5-9 建構資料流程圖繪製原則
5-10 實務專題製作
第 6 章 結構化係統分析與設計工具
6-1 結構化係統分析與設計工具
6-2 資料字典(Data Dictionary)
6-3 決策錶(Decision Table)
6-4 決策樹(Decision Tree)
6-5 結構化英文(Structure English)
第 7 章 係統設計
7-1 係統設計的基本概念
7-2 輸齣設計(Output Design)
7-3 輸入設計(Input Design)
7-4 資料庫設計(Data Base Design)
7-5 處理設計(Process Design)
7-6 控製設計(Control Design)
7-7 撰寫「係統設計規格書」
7-8 實例探討與研究
第 8 章 資料塑模
8-1 資料塑模設計
8-2 實體關係模式的概念
8-3 實體(Entity)
8-4 屬性(Attribute)
8-5 關係(Relationship)
8-6 情境轉換成E-R Model
8-7 將ER圖轉換成對應錶格的法則
8-8 正規化(Normalization)
8-9 結語
 第 9 章 係統製作
9-1 係統製作
9-2 撰寫程式
9-3 軟體測試(Testing)
9-4 軟體的四階段測試
9-5 係統轉換(System Conversion)
第 1 0 章 係統維護
10-1 係統維護的概念
10-2 係統維護生命週期
10-3 係統維護的需求
10-4 係統維護的類別
第 1 1 章 專題製作
11-1 資訊係統之專題製作介紹
11-2 摘要
11-2 研究動機與目的
11-3 文獻探討
11-4 係統分析與設計
11-5 係統實作與應用
11-6 討論與建議
第 1 2 章 係統文件製作
12-1 係統文件製作
12-2 係統文件的製作原則
12-3 係統開發各階段文件
12-4 可行性報告書(係統建議書)
12-5 軟體需求規格書
12-6 係統設計規格書
12-7 係統說明文件
12-8 程式說明文件
12-9 使用者手冊
12-10 操作者手冊
 

圖書序言

  • ISBN:9786263282926
  • 叢書係列:大專資訊
  • 規格:平裝 / 448頁 / 19 x 26 x 2.24 cm / 普通級 / 單色印刷 / 二版
  • 齣版地:颱灣

圖書試讀

用户评价

评分

對於我這種已經在業界摸爬滾打幾年的工程師來說,這本《圖解係統分析與設計(第二版增訂版)》最讓我驚豔的,是它對「變更管理」和「文件標準化」這些「軟實力」的著墨。很多時候,係統開發的難處不在於寫程式,而在於跨部門溝通和後續的維護。這本書對於UML圖錶的應用講解得非常到位,它不隻是教你畫圖,更重要的是教你「為什麼要畫這個圖」,以及這個圖在不同階段(從初版到增訂版)應該如何演進。例如,它對「Use Case Diagram」的描述,就比我過去看過的任何教材都要細膩,特別是在邊界條件和例外情況的處理上。另一個讓我印象深刻的是,書中討論到資料庫設計時,不再隻是停留在正規化的理論層麵,而是結閤瞭效能考量去談「反正規化」的時機點,這類實戰經驗的分享,對於想從初階邁嚮資深架構師的人來說,簡直是無價之寶。這已經不是單純的教學書,更像是一本濃縮瞭多年實務經驗的工具書。

评分

我會嚮我那些剛畢業,或者正在準備IT類證照考試的朋友推薦這本書,但不是把重點放在背誦定義上。我推薦的點在於,它建立瞭一套完整的「係統思考框架」。很多新手會遇到的盲點是,他們一拿到需求就想著要用什麼技術棧來解決,但這本書卻不斷拉高視角,教你如何先界定問題的邊界,如何與利害關係人有效溝通,以及如何將複雜的流程拆解成可管理的模組。光是書中對於「係統介麵設計」的章節,就讓我重新審視瞭過去自己設計介麵的粗糙之處。它強調的「使用者體驗」與「後端邏輯」之間的協同作用,並非單純的美工或程式問題,而是一個結構性的設計決策。這本書的「增訂版」在很多細節上做瞭更新,看得齣來有持續追蹤技術演進,使得內容的時效性有保障,這在快速迭代的資訊領域中非常重要。總而言之,它成功地將原本被視為「枯燥」的工程學科,轉化成一門充滿邏輯美感的藝術。

评分

這本書的封麵設計還蠻吸引人的,那種藍綠色調的搭配,給人一種專業又不失親和力的感覺。一翻開內頁,那個排版真的讓人眼睛一亮,圖文並茂的呈現方式,對於我這種不是科班齣身,但又對資訊係統開發有興趣的人來說,簡直是救星。特別是那個「係統分析」的章節,很多理論性的東西,過去看教科書都覺得枯燥乏味,但這本透過大量的圖示和流程圖去解釋,像是把抽象的概念具象化瞭,連帶著那些複雜的名詞解釋也變得容易理解。而且,它很注重「實務」的連結,書裡麵舉的例子都不是那種天馬行空的虛構情境,而是貼近一般企業會遇到的問題,這點對於想要轉行或自我提升的人來說,非常實用。光是光碟裡麵的那些範例,我覺得光是研究這些範例程式碼跟資料流圖,可能就要花上不少時間,但絕對是值得的投資,畢竟光是「如何開始」這個門檻,這本書就幫我跨過去一大半瞭。整體來說,它在視覺傳達和內容結構上的用心,讓人感受到作者群的功力,不是那種隨便拼湊的翻譯書可以比擬的。

评分

說真的,現在市麵上在談「係統分析與設計」的書,要找到一本兼顧「深度」跟「廣度」,還能用這麼生活化的語言去闡述的,實在是鳳毛麟角。我記得以前在學校上課時,老師教的那些結構化分析、物件導嚮設計的基礎,總是讓我抓不到重點,感覺像是學瞭一堆工具卻不知道該用在什麼地方。這本書厲害的地方就在於,它沒有一頭熱地隻講最新的熱門技術,而是先把基礎的「思維模式」建立起來。它花瞭相當大的篇幅去強調「需求訪談」的重要性,這部分在很多技術書裡常被一筆帶過,但作者卻用好幾個案例說明,如果前端的需求釐清不夠徹底,後麵寫程式碼寫得再漂亮都是白搭。這種由「業務理解」導嚮「技術實現」的邏輯推演,讓我對整個專案的生命週期有瞭更宏觀的認識。而且,它在描述各種設計方法時,都會很清楚地比較優缺點,讓讀者可以根據不同的專案規模或產業特性,做齣最適閤的選擇,而不是盲目套用單一範本。

评分

坦白說,我對於厚重的技術書籍通常抱持著敬而遠之的態度,總覺得內容空泛、印刷粗糙,但這本的裝訂和紙質處理得相當不錯,長時間閱讀下來眼睛負擔也比較小。翻到後麵的章節,關於「測試策略」和「部署考量」的部分,讓我耳目一新。以往的分析設計書通常在係統建置完成後就戛然而止,但這本卻很有前瞻性地提到瞭敏捷開發環境下的迭代式設計,以及如何將測試計畫融入分析階段。這顯示齣作者群對於當前軟體工程實務的掌握度很高,畢竟現代軟體開發早已不是瀑布式的線性流程。特別是它對於「非功能性需求」(如安全性、可擴展性)的探討,不像很多書隻是蜻蜓點水,而是提供瞭具體的量化指標和評估模型,這對於編寫高品質的係統規格書來說,提供瞭非常具體的參考依據。這本書的涵蓋範圍之廣,幾乎能應付從專案啟動到驗收交付的全程需求,非常全麵。

相关图书

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2025 twbook.tinynews.org All Rights Reserved. 灣灣書站 版權所有